Can someone explain to me what is meant by "physical hosting" along with the other two hosting styles? I am new to Plesk and don't know what these mean.

TIA
 
physical hosting: Webpages, images, ... (all content) is stored on the harddisk of your plesk-server.

The other hosting types are just different "redirectors". The content is stored on an other server with an other URL. You can redirect visitors from www.example.com to www.example.net/~johndoe/homepage/ or something like that.
